Skip to content

Instantly share code, notes, and snippets.

@pYr0x
Created September 11, 2018 21:51
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save pYr0x/99d4a46593bce1b6d651d1ff25a52cce to your computer and use it in GitHub Desktop.
Save pYr0x/99d4a46593bce1b6d651d1ff25a52cce to your computer and use it in GitHub Desktop.
import {Component, DefineMap} from "can";
import view from "./entnahmestelle-list.stache";
const ViewModel = DefineMap.extend("ListVM", {
msg: {
default: "foo"
}
});
Component.extend({
tag: "x-entnahmestelle-list",
ViewModel,
view,
events: {}
});
<x-import>
<div class="container-fluid px-0">
<div class="row">
<div class="col-3">
<x-entnahmestelle-list vm:msg:to="bar"></x-entnahmestelle-list>
</div>
<div class="col">
{{bar}}
</div>
</div>
<div class="form-group row justify-content-end">
<div class="col-4 text-right form-controls">
<button type="submit" class="btn btn-success" role="button"><i class="fa fa-save"></i> Speichern</button>
<button class="btn btn-secondary" role="back">Abbrechen</button>
</div>
</div>
</x-import>
import {Component, DefineMap} from "can";
import "~/components/entnahmestelle-list/";
const ViewModel = DefineMap.extend("ImportVM", {
bar: "string"
});
Component.extend({
tag: "x-import",
ViewModel,
view: `<content/>`,
events: {}
});
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ment